onethingwell: Send files to your Habilis email address and they show up in your Dropbox.com dropbox a few seconds later - simple! It’s dead handy for devices like the iPad where you can create documents but can’t easily get them into your Dropbox.

why poverty is not the opposite of wealth
therealestsocksinthegame: novazembla: myvivavoce: kungfucarrie: smartchickscommune: “[Charles] Karelis, a professor at George Washington University, has a simpler but far more radical argument to make: traditional economics just doesn’t apply to the poor. When we’re poor, Karelis argues, our economic worldview is shaped by deprivation, and we see the world around us not in terms of...

Little known secret: if the U.S. House of Representatives stops funding a war, or any other crime, neither the Senate nor the President nor the military can continue the killing.  The Chairman of the House Appropriations Committee, David Obey, can single-handedly block funding to escalate the war in Afghanistan, and currently he is doing so by refusing to advance it unless schools and jobs are...
